FAQs About Septic Services in Eden Valley

Every three years is the standard timeframe to prevent solids from clogging your drainfield and damaging the soil. Regular service protects the soil's ability to filter wastewater effectively and complies with local health recommendations.
Yes, a compliance inspection must be completed within three years of any property sale in Minnesota. This ensures the system meets current MPCA safety standards and does not pose a threat to the local groundwater before the new owner moves in.
Winter pumping is rare and difficult because the ground freezes four to five feet deep between November and April. It is best to schedule maintenance during the summer or fall to avoid the extra labor costs of digging through frozen Minnesota soil.
Systems identified as an imminent threat to public health must be replaced or upgraded within ten months. Local county zoning officials oversee these mandatory upgrades to ensure all household waste is treated according to state environmental laws.
High water tables during the spring thaw can temporarily saturate the clay loam soil around your drainfield, causing slow drains. Reducing indoor water use during these wet weeks helps prevent backups while the ground is saturated with snowmelt.

Local Septic Landscape

Soil in this region varies from clay loam to glacial till, which demands specific system designs to handle the slow percolation. Because the Minnesota frost line reaches depths of 42 to 60 inches, tanks are often buried deep or insulated to survive the freeze. Most local homes use 1,000 or 1,500-gallon tanks to manage household waste throughout the long winters that grip the area from November through April.

Regulations & Permitting

Minnesota Rules Chapter 7080-7083 dictate that only licensed professionals handle septic designs and installations in the local county. Residents must provide a compliance inspection certificate within three years of selling a home to meet state requirements. If a system poses a health threat, the MPCA mandates repairs within a strict ten-month window, and the local County Environmental Services oversees these local property transfers.

Environmental Factors

The water table around Eden Valley shifts between 3 and 20 feet, making spring snowmelt a real concern for drainfield performance. Properties located in shoreland districts near local lakes face even stricter setbacks to prevent groundwater contamination. These environmental factors make the recommended three-year pumping cycle a necessity for protecting the surrounding landscape and ensuring the sandy loam remains porous.

Local Cost Factors

Expect to pay around $300 to $550 for a standard septic pumping service in the Eden Valley area. These costs can increase if the tank lid is buried deep beneath the frost line or if the system has been neglected for more than three years. Investing in regular maintenance is the best way to avoid the high price of a full system replacement following a drainfield failure.
